Abstract

A printer controller wherein original outline data representative of the outline of a figure are converted by an approximating device into approximative outline data including straight segment data representative straight segments which approximate curved segments of the original outline. The approximating device is adapted to lower the accuracy of approximation of the curved segments by the straight segments, until the amount of the approximation data is reduced to such an extent that the approximative data can be entirely stored in a currently available empty area of a random-access memory, before the approximative data are converted into bit map data representative of image dots filling the interior of the figure outline.
